Stone Golem
Construct made of stone that can cast slow spells

A stone golem is created through use of a magical text or by a 16th or higher level magic user using the following spells: geas, slow, wish and polymorph object. Creation time is two months and cost is 1,000 gp per hit point of the golem.
The magic user can control his or her creation through simple commands. The golem can also be ordered to suspend movement until a particular condition is met.
Special Abilities
Slow Spell: A stone golem can cast a slow spell every other melee round on all opponents within 10-ft of its front.
Immunity to Normal and +1 Weapons: Only magical weapons of +2 or greater bonus can harm a stone golem.
Spell Immunity: Such a golem is also invulnerable to most magic, the only exceptions being rock to mud which halves the golem’s attack and movement speed for 2d6 rounds, stone to flesh which makes it susceptible to normal weapons for one round, and mud to rock which acts as a heal spell on the monster.
